TRAINING ASSESSOR
OXFORDSHIRE
£30,000 - £31,000
As a Training Assessor, you will join the Learning & Development team, supporting care and support staff to achieve their health and social care qualifications (Level 2-5). You’ll undertake assessments, ensuring the delivery of high-quality, cost-effective programmes.

RESPONSIBILITIES
As Training Assessor your key duties will include:
- Support a caseload of learners across Oxfordshire, meeting with them on a regular basis to support and evidence their learning.
- Assess whether learner evidence meets the required standards for the qualification and unit criteria.
- Attend regular meetings at head office to collaborate with the national team and ensure standardisation.
- Continue your own professional development to retain competency in assessing Health and Social care qualifications.
REQUIRED SKILLS & EXPERIENCE
To be considered for the role of Training Assessor, you must have:
- A Level 3 Assessor qualification - D32, D33, TAQA L3 or equivalent.
- Health and social care qualifications / significant experience within the space.
- A full UK driving licence.
- Recent experience of undertaking a similar role undertaking assessments of Health and Social care programmes
- Working knowledge of relevant legislation and good practice principles
- Flexibility to travel across the region and further afield to monthly meetings
